This newly-revised guidebook from the Cultural Orientation Resource Center was created to help refugees adjust to their new lives in the United States. Topics include:
- Pre-arrival processing
- Resettlement agency
- Community services
- Housing
- Transportation
- Employment
- Health care
- Money management
- Cultural adjustment
- Rights and responsibilities of refugees
The guidebook is available in the following languages: English, Albanian, Amharic, Arabic, Bosnian/Croatian/Serbian, Farsi, French, Karen, Kirundi, Nepali, Russian, Somali, Spanish, Swahili, Tigrinya and Vietnamese.
Limited quantities of the guidebook are provided free of charge to Refugee Resettlement Agencies. Others can order the guidebook for $12.
